An die Entwickler und Admins von MP bezüglich Shuttering (1 Viewer)

davitzen

MP Donator
  • Premium Supporter
  • May 30, 2008
    198
    7
    Berlin
    Home Country
    Germany Germany
    AW: An die Entwickler und Admins von MP bezüglich Shuttering

    Hallo!

    Superspeed Ramdisk Plus macht das und nutzt den Speicher "über" der Grenze. Wichtig hierbei ist der PAE Modus, der muss aktiviert werden. siehe hier und hier

    lG David

    PS: Ruckeln habe ich auch, es ist unzumutbar!


    Hi!

    Ich habe genau die selben Probleme. Leider funktionieren die Lösungen hier nicht... Es ist zum heulen. Alle sind glücklich dass jetzt alles super flüssig läuft, nur bei mir wieder nicht.
    Es sieht folgendermaßen aus:
    Es handelt sich beim Server und Client um MePo 1.1.0 RC4.
    Auch ich hatte alle 5-10 Minuten in unregelmäßigen Abständen das Bildstottern. Das war nach ein paar Sekunden erledigt, hat aber trotzdem genervt.
    Wenn ich jetzt den Client auf UNC umstelle, dann ruckelts wie blöde, und zwar die ganze Zeit. Woran kann das denn nun wieder liegen? Mit RTSP lief alles flüssig, nur halt hin und wieder die Hänger. Und bei euch funktioniert´s ja auch wunderbar.
    Habe dann noch die Festplatten auf AHCI umgestellt. UNC ruckelt damit immernoch. RTSP läuft nun flüssig und auch etwas länger. Aber nach ungefähr einer halben Stunde bleibt das Bild komplett stehen. Manchmal bricht MP komplett zusammen und es hilft nur ein Neustart, manchmal fängt es sich wieder durch Skippen. Spult man zurück ist aber der Timeshift-Buffer komplett flüssig.
    Das Problem tritt auch auf, wenn ich den Timeshift-Ordner auf meine SSD verschiebe.
    Was kann ich noch ausprobieren?

    Würde nun auch gerne eine RAM-Disk für´s Timeshifting einrichten, nur mal zum Testen. Gibt es irgendwo eine Anleitung, welches Programm man am besten dafür nutzt? Zweites Problem: Habe nur XP 32 Bit. Kann man ohne kommerzielle Software auch mehr als 4 GB (3,25 GB) Speicher nutzen?

    Danke und Grüße!
     

    Wondermusic

    Retired Extension Developer
  • Premium Supporter
  • September 7, 2009
    1,117
    275
    Wuppertal
    Home Country
    Germany Germany
    AW: An die Entwickler und Admins von MP bezüglich Shuttering

    Mit RC4 habe ich jetzt noch nicht getestet, aber wenns vorher schon so war, dann hilft eventuell mal ein anderer Codec? Habe jetzt nicht lesen können das Du damit schon probiert hast... Verwende mal den neuesten SAF5er. Auch wenn jetzt wahrscheinlich wieder Stimmen laut werden von wegen "Hände weg von Codec- Packs" aber damit hatte ich bisher keine Probleme. Ich habe bei mir Live-TV mit dem PDVD10 Codec laufen und das Bild ist einwandfrei.

    Timeshift würde ich auf HDD belassen - Deine Platte sollte dafür definitiv schnell genug sein und viele Schreibvorgänge auf ner SSD sind nicht besonders gut für die Lebensdauer.

    Was die Ram-Disk angeht hatte ich mal die von QSoft drauf. Die funktionierte ganz gut, aber da ich selber nur 3GB im Server habe reicht mir die speicherbare Zeit teilweise nicht, daher bin ich wieder auf HDD umgestiegen. Und nein - es gibt keine Möglichkeit WinXP mit mehr als 3GB nutzbarem Speicher zu betreiben.

    Gruß,
    Wondermusic

    EDIT: Oh, da war einer schneller :D
    Echt? Gehts das tatsächlich mit mehr als 3GB? Man lernt doch nie aus! :)
     

    scranagar

    Portal Pro
    November 30, 2009
    84
    2
    AW: An die Entwickler und Admins von MP bezüglich Shuttering

    davitzen
    Hast Du das zufällig schonmal ausprobiert, ob damit bspw. eine RAM Disk > 4 GB unter XP 32 Bit eingerichtet werden kann...?

    Ich habe jetzt mal eine RAM Disk mit 2 GB angelegt. Es sieht bisher ganz vielversprechend aus, kann aber erst mehr sagen, wenn ich nachher zum Fernsehen gekommen bin. Hab im Moment nicht genug Zeit ;)

    Wondermusic
    Ich bin mir relativ sicher, dass es nicht am Codec liegt... Denn, je nachdem wo ich den Timeshift Ordner hin schiebe und ob ich AHCI oder IDE Modus verwende, verhält sich der Client anders.
    Im IDE Modus auf der "normalen" Platte: Kurze Ruckler alle paar Minuten
    Im AHCI Modus auf der SSD: Keine Ruckler, dafür nach ca. einer halben Stunde kompletter Zusammenbruch des Streams
    Und bis die Fehler auftreten ist alles super flüssig.

    AHCI mit der normalen Patte und IDE mit der SSD hab ich jetzt noch nicht im Detail getestet. Denn es dauert halt immer relativ lang, bis sich das bemerkbar macht.

    Was mich wurmt: Am Server selbst läuft alles absolut problemlos. Egal, wie ich´s einstelle. Die Probleme sind nur beim Streamen. Ich habe unterschiedlichste Hardware probiert (vom kleinen Intel Atom bis zum Highend Gamer PC). Bei allen (auch am Server) ist SAF installiert.
    Netzwerk-Problematiken würd ich zunächst auch ausschließen. 100 MBit/s wired sollten ausreichen...
    Ich bin auf das RAM Disk Experiment gespannt. Werde morgen berichten.

    Grüße
     

    Wondermusic

    Retired Extension Developer
  • Premium Supporter
  • September 7, 2009
    1,117
    275
    Wuppertal
    Home Country
    Germany Germany
    AW: An die Entwickler und Admins von MP bezüglich Shuttering

    Ich bin mir nicht sicher ob unterschiedliche Timings der einzelnen PC's da auch eine Rolle spielen. Auf dem Server ist ja auch nicht anders als auf einem Client. Der Server wird genauso mit einem Stream versorgt wie der Client auch. Nur das Du halt hier ein Multiseat- System hast und kein Singleseat.

    Ich hatte Anfangs auch alles im Wohnzimmer stehen - also einen PC auf dem alles lief (dort war damals auch noch die TV- Karte eingebaut). Da hatte ich auch nie Probleme!
    Als ich dann auf Multi umgestiegen bin, weil mir die ganzen Platten im Wohnzimmer zu laut wurden und die Kühlung auch nur schwer leise zu realisieren war, fingen die Probleme genauso an.
    Mit viel testen und probieren (und beinahe den Hals umgedreht bekommen) habe ich es jetzt endlich geschafft ein einwandfrei laufendes System hinzubekommen.
    Was auch viel (zumindest objektiv gesehen) gebracht hat, war die Neuformatierung des Servers und Installation mit gleichem Betriebssystem wie auf den Clients. Hier läuft nun überall Win7 (Wohnzimmer und Server auf 32Bit, sowie Arbeitszimmer und Laptop mit 64Bit). Weniger Ruckler sowohl beim TV schauen als auch bei Videos waren das erste sichtbare Ergebnis, testen mit verschiedenen Codecs und der Austausch der oben genannten dll waren weitere "Meilensteine". Und zu guter letzt der Ausbau des Servers auf 3GB hat es letztlich dann gebracht.
    Wie gesagt - jetzt läuft alles und meine Frau will mich auch nicht mehr erwürgen... :D

    Gruß,
    Wondermusic
     

    davitzen

    MP Donator
  • Premium Supporter
  • May 30, 2008
    198
    7
    Berlin
    Home Country
    Germany Germany
    AW: An die Entwickler und Admins von MP bezüglich Shuttering

    @davitzen
    Hast Du das zufällig schonmal ausprobiert, ob damit bspw. eine RAM Disk > 4 GB unter XP 32 Bit eingerichtet werden kann...?

    Ich habe jetzt mal eine RAM Disk mit 2 GB angelegt. Es sieht bisher ganz vielversprechend aus, kann aber erst mehr sagen, wenn ich nachher zum Fernsehen gekommen bin. Hab im Moment nicht genug Zeit ;)

    Nein, habe ich noch nicht, da ich nur max. 6GB Ram hatte. Ich hatte immer um die 2GB vergeben, man soll ja nicht 2h im Timeshift zurückspulen!

    lG David
     

    scranagar

    Portal Pro
    November 30, 2009
    84
    2
    AW: An die Entwickler und Admins von MP bezüglich Shuttering

    So, hier nun mein Bericht...
    Ich habe gestern Abend etwa 3 Stunden vor dem Fernseher (Client) verbracht.
    Ich habe mir Aufnahmen angesehen, Live TV geschaut, SD und HD.
    Hauptsächlich habe ich mich auf Live TV (HD) konzentriert und mir ein paar Reportagen auf History HD und National Geographic HD angesehen. Das waren auch die Sender, bei denen definitiv die Probleme bestanden.
    Nun, mit dem Timeshiftfolder auf der RAM Disk läuft das TV absolut ruckelfrei. Nicht ein Hänger, kein Ruckler, geschweige denn Zusammenbruch des Streams waren zu beobachten. Es lief genau so, wie ich mir das vorgestellt habe!
    Also scheint da doch noch irgendwas mit den Festplatten im Argen zu sein...
    Ich würde die RAM Disk ja auch gerne belassen, die positiven Nebeneffekte wie superschnelles Timeshiften sprechen für sich.
    Jetzt muss ich nur noch einen Weg finden, die RAM Disk größer zu bekommen. Und das unter XP 32 Bit :D
    Ich weiß, man soll nicht 2 h timeshiften. Aber 2 GB reichen für gerade mal 20 Minuten HD, und hin und wieder kommt es bei nem 2 oder 3 Stunden Programm schon vor, dass da diese Menge an Pausen zwischendurch kommt.

    btw mein Stream läuft nach wie vor über RTSP, falls andere Leser weiterhin Schwierigkeiten haben sollten.

    Grüße und Danke für Eure Hilfe!

    Wondermusic said:
    (und beinahe den Hals umgedreht bekommen)

    Genau DAS ist nämlich auch mein Problem. Die Frau will im Schlafzimmer einwandfreies Fernsehen haben. Lief ja schließlich vorher auch einwandfrei (analog TV über´n Tuner des TV im Schlafzimmer).
    Sie versteht den Unterschied nicht zum MePo. Sie ist zwar ganz froh, dass sie jetzt Ihre Aufnahmen und Sky und alles im Schlafzimmer auch gucken kann, aber tortzdem ist erstmal grundsätzlich alles scheiße so lange es nicht perfekt läuft. Ich glaub, Frauen sind einfach so. Ich musste auch schon wüste Beschimpfungen ertragen wie scheiße mein "Projekt" doch sei. Naja, Augen zu und durch. Es nähert sich ja langsam den Vorstellungen.
     

    polarie

    Retired Team Member
  • Premium Supporter
  • November 20, 2006
    1,252
    152
    52
    Hasloh (near Hamburg)
    Home Country
    Germany Germany
    AW: An die Entwickler und Admins von MP bezüglich Shuttering

    nicht aufgeben scranager ...

    auch bei mir war es so - und wenns updates oder neue plugins gibt ist es wieder so ...

    mittlerweile weiß meine fau aber das man(n) bemüht ist es schnellst möglich zum laufen zu bringen ...
    und wenns dann läuft überwiegen klar die vorteile von MePo :)

    timeshift und aufnamhmen eben auchbei sky etc. alles dinge die sie nicht mehr missen will ...
    von daher ist der gesammt WAF hoch..


    was das ruckeln angeht ...
    ich habe diese problem vor langer zeit mal gehabt ...
    gelöst durch zwei HDD betrieb ...

    hab bei der multiseat für den server (im Ursprung)
    2 x 500 Gig genommen ...(EDIT: jetzt sinds zwei 2.5" 80er - weniger strom/hitze im TV-Betrieb)
    2 REALE HDD's - je 2 x partitioniert -
    also am Beispiel meines Servers:

    platte 1= 500 gig
    C: 10 gig (system WIN und MePO + auslagerungsdatei)
    E: 490 gig ( z.b.filme und musik)

    platte 2 = 500 gig
    D: 10 gig (timeshift-buffer)
    F: 490 gig (z.B.serien)

    EDIT:
    falls möglich - eine reale 3 platte mit einer extra 5 gig partition für die auslagerungsdatei
    - REST für z.B. Aufnahmen...
    DANN - ist es noch perfomanter - quasie bis nach meppen und zurück...

    (lohnt aber erst bei Multi-Seat und File-services ... imho ... :D
    weil man die "restpartitionen" sinnvoll für filme-sammlungen nutzen kann)

    und dann "überkreuz" ...
    d.h. die auslagerungsdatei von windows auf der system/startpartiton belasen (da wo auch windows installiert ist)
    aber den timeshift buffer auf der ersten partition der zweiten platte gelegt.

    vorteil ... bei dieser konstellation kommen sich die datenpakete auf dem BUS nicht ins gehege ...
    timeshift kann absolut alleine durchgeführt werden ohne das rucklen aufkommen kann
    (der schreibzyklus-interrupt für z.B auslagerungsdatei fällt da dann nämlich weg)
    auf der zweiten partition der zweiten platte habe ich serien und musik gelegt.
    denn wenn ich serien oder filme von der platte guck, brauch ich kein timeshift...:D

    da reicht dann auch 1 gig RAM auf server UND auf dem client lasche 2 gig (wegen onBoard Grafik - sonst 1 gig genug)...
    bei singelseat reichen auch 2 gig ... mehr brauchts wirklich nicht ....
    und egal wieviel RAM man drinn hat - Windows lagert immer aus...

    ruckeln adieu --- und das schon insgesammt bei 3 aufgesetzten geräten mit unterschiedlicher hardware ...
    singleseat - UND multiseat.... nur das mittlerweile ein paar mehr HDD'S in meinem system werkeln ...
    (und auch klar das Multiseat immer bissi längere umschaltzeiten hat...)


    gemacht mit 1.0.0 - 1.0.1 - 1.0.2 und auch mit RC2, 3 und 4 (die RC1 hab ich ausgelassen) multiseat und auch singelseat
    kein ruckeln ...ATI oder nVidia ... egal ... (ab nforce8200 und/oder G780/G785 jeweils onboard)

    EDIT 2:
    ich timeshifte mitlerweile mit insgesammt 15 GIG für 3 karten (eine dual-DVB-S und eine DVB-S2 je 5 gig)
    sch** egal wie lange und wie weit ich springe ...
    wobei eben mein dedizierter server mittlerweile ein paar mehr HDDs zur verfügung stellt und hat :)

    bevorzuge eh festplatten statt RAM -
    was kosten 2 Gig RAM ?
    auch nicht viel mehr oder weniger als eine
    250er/500er HDD ...

    EDIT-Drölf:
    :D Ram-Disk wird Überbewertet ... :p
     

    scranagar

    Portal Pro
    November 30, 2009
    84
    2
    AW: An die Entwickler und Admins von MP bezüglich Shuttering

    Sooo, viele Platten habe ich leider nicht zur Verfügung. Aber ich werd damit nochmal ein wenig rum probieren. Das dauert allerdings noch seine Zeit. Verschiedene Partitionen für Auslagerungsdatei und Timeshift und Aufnahmen machen in der Tat Sinn!
    Im Moment habe ich auf der SSD nur eine Partition für Windows und MePo. Auf der zweiten hatte ich den Timeshift Ordner und das Verzeichnis für Aufnahmen.
    Von der SSD wollte ich nochmal die Auslagerungsdatei runter nehmen, um die Schreibvorgänge auf die teure Platte zu minimieren.

    Zwei Ideen sind mir auch noch gekommen, wo vielleicht der Hase im Pfeffer liegen könnte:
    1. Dieser Thread hier: https://forum.team-mediaportal.com/tv-streaming-480/frage-n-zu-min-und-max-beim-timeshift-83414/
    Könnte es tatsächlich sein, dass die Ruckler entstehen wenn eine neue Timeshift-Datei angefangen wird? Zeitlich könnte es so so ungefähr hin kommen.

    2. Vielleicht auch im Zusammenhang mit 1.: Durch das ständige Aufnehmen und Löschen dürfte die Platte stark fragmentiert sein. Ich werde nochmal defragmentieren und nochmal testen.

    Bisher lässt sich bei mir lediglich festhalten: Verschieben des Timeshifts in eine RAM Disk behebt das Ruckel-Problem.

    Grüße

    P.S.: Arbeitsspeicher ist ja im Moment schweine-teuer....
     

    polarie

    Retired Team Member
  • Premium Supporter
  • November 20, 2006
    1,252
    152
    52
    Hasloh (near Hamburg)
    Home Country
    Germany Germany
    AW: An die Entwickler und Admins von MP bezüglich Shuttering

    also das mit dem min. max köntne auch noch was sein ...

    (werd mal testen :D für den hinweis)

    fragmentierung sollte eigentich nicht so sehr auftreten da
    der timeshiftbuffer nach abschalten myTV fragmentfrei gelöscht werden sollte ...
    (wobei ich nicht weiß ob nur verzeichnisse gelöscht werden oder tatsächlich
    die datei)
    wäre noch ein extra-TS-Buffer-partitions vorteil ... :D
    von zeit zu zeit formatieren ..dann isser wieder "clean" ...
    und 10 gig sind schnell formatiert ...

    und-
    wenn die RAM-disk deine probleme behebt würd ich das so lassen
    SSD mit wenig R/W zyklen belasten ist auch besser so ...
    bin noch sehr skeptisch was SSD angeht und die zyklenfestigkeit ...
     

    scranagar

    Portal Pro
    November 30, 2009
    84
    2
    AW: An die Entwickler und Admins von MP bezüglich Shuttering

    Wie gesagt, die RAM-Disk ist mir ja eigentlich zu klein. Aber zunächst werde ich es so lassen und wenn ich genügend Zeit und Ruhe habe (oder mich die Frau nervt, dass sie jetzt nicht mehr 3 Stunden während eines Films telefonieren und so lange "Pause" drücken kann) die verschiedenen Festplatten-Konfigurations-Szenarien austesten.

    Da ich die selbe Festplatte für Aufnahmen und Timeshift nutze, denke ich, dass die starke Fragmentierung eher vom Schreiben und Löschen der Aufnahmen kommt, weniger vom Timeshift-Buffer. Aber wenn der über weite Teile der Platte springen muss, könnte es ja auch sein dass es Schwierigkeiten gibt... Wobei das ja eigentlich soooo lange auch nicht dauern sollte. Hab auch nicht wirklich Lust, alle zwei Wochen zu defragmentieren. Das dauert immer so lang ;)

    Was Deine Skepsis bzgl. SSD angeht: Die kann ich teilen. Ich habe auch lange überlegt ob ich so viel Geld für ne Platte ausgebe, die eh nur sehr klein ist und auch noch schnell kaputt geht. Aber der Luxus eines 5-Sekunden-Bootvorgangs war´s mir wert. Ich bin gespannt und hoffe, dass die Platte lang genug hält. Wenn sie ein paar Jahre hält, bin ich zufrieden.

    Grüße

    Edit: Typo
     

    Users who are viewing this thread

    Top Bottom